		    <description><![CDATA[<p>@<a href="#c3880928">DMDDallas</a>: <br>
You may want to:</p>
<p>1. Watch the Flexyourrights.org video entitled " BUSTED: The Citizen's Guide to Surviving Police Encounters" <a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=yqMjMPlXzdA;">[www.youtube.com]</a> and</p>
<p>2. Print out the ACLU's "bust card" that details what you should do when you are stopped <a href="http://www.joshdale.com/bustcard.pdf">[www.joshdale.com]</a></p>
<p>They should answer your questions better. generally though keep in mind Courts recognize these levels of police-citizen contact: (a) community caretaking, or public safety - not a seizure and requires no legal justification; (b) limited, brief investigatory stop - justified if reasonable suspicion of criminal activity; and (c) an arrest - justified with warrant or when probable cause that a crime had occurred and person arrested was involved in the crime.</p> <p>Curiosity</p>]]></description>

		    <description><![CDATA[<p>This is a consumer issue b/c if you read the police report it was a McDonald's employee who gave the statement making it vague whom exactly had the issue with the lady, the police or the business. I somewhat assume that this is private property.</p>
<p>@<a href="#c3877496">pylon83</a>: <br>
Generally the black letter law for stopping is the "Terry rule" <a href="http://www.soc.umn.edu/%7Esamaha/cases/terry%20v%20ohio.html">[www.soc.umn.edu]</a>  :<br>
If there is no probable cause, no warrant, and no consent then: If there is a reasonable suspicion that a crime is about to take place, officers can stop and ask questions, and if the answers do not dispel suspicion, then they can pat down the outer garments and "create" probable cause (usually if identifiable weapons).</p>
<p>Obviously though there is a lesser expectation of privacy in cars which is governed by probable cause and the ability of the police to seize and inventory the car.</p>
<p>Here though this is probably governed by state law and local ordinances <a href="http://www.municode.com/resources/gateway.asp?pid=10148&amp;sid=9">[www.municode.com]</a> . Clearwater I believe has adopted the Florida Uniform Traffic Control Law, and empowered their police via " It is unlawful and a misdemeanor of the second degree, punishable as provided in s. 775.082 or s. 775.083, for any person willfully to fail or refuse to comply with any lawful order or direction of any law enforcement officer, traffic crash investigation officer as described in s. 316.640, traffic infraction enforcement officer as described in s. 316.640, or member of the fire department at the scene of a fire, rescue operation, or other emergency."</p> <p>Curiosity</p>]]></description>
